Output ebccc7f09a27bebe9c8196d598957fb04d6780e65d2cb41880d8672517df52af:44

value
32348094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cffb33de54028193075fec38b70ed6188da1525 OP_EQUAL
address
MDTh6JHUYmsRZidagMZYqSpkephnjQ6p6n
transaction
ebccc7f09a27bebe9c8196d598957fb04d6780e65d2cb41880d8672517df52af
spent
true